Is sports activities betting lawful?

Considered one of the greatest questions encompassing sports betting is if the activity is authorized. The fact is that in lots of parts of the earth, sports activities betting is lawful. Nearly all of Europe and Asia control sports betting rather seriously, but bettors can position their wagers with out anxiety of legal reprisals.

North The united states is another Tale. In copyright and the United States, wagering on sports is just essentially allowed in four states: Nevada, Delaware, Montana, and Oregon. Of those, only Nevada basically permits athletics gambling outfits to work.

Now, this doesn't necessarily indicate that North Us residents are out of luck if they would like to wager over a activity. The web has opened up an array of prospects for people west of the Atlantic to locations bets on sports activities, Despite the fact that they have to do this as a result of guides operated in a region where sports gambling is authorized. However, the status of These operations is a bit shady.

So how exactly does sporting activities betting do the job?

Formal athletics bets, All those which happen by way of bookies as an alternative to buddies, are meticulously measured odds offered by shrewd company number crunchers. Whether or not we've been speaking about Las Vegas or Beijing, you may ensure that the books are one action forward of your ordinary bettor In regards to wagering.

This isn't to state that You do not stand a probability of profitable any time you spot a guess, for the reason that among the list of appeals of laying a wager on the sporting activities occasion is that victory is equal pieces expertise and luck (as opposed to casino wagering, which is essentially just luck regardless of what Charlton Heston has to state!).

The sports publications present a number of unique types of bets, all of which might be designed so that the ebook alone tends to make a income it doesn't matter royal paiza club the outcome in the celebration. That gain is called the vigorish (vig for short). It's usually all around $ten, compensated by the one that loses the wager.

Frequently, bettors will choose among two choices when wagering on a sports activities function. The primary is The cash line, where a straight up earn via the workforce picked will bring about money returned to the bettor. They look like this, in a

baseball game:

Chicago White Sox -two hundred
Big apple Yankees +a hundred and fifty

That illustration tells us two factors. For starters, the White Sox tend to be the favorites. That is indicated through the damaging sign. If you guess the Sox, then It's important to place down $two hundred so that you can earn $one hundred. Which is the next point the example demonstrates us; the amounts indicate the amount you acquire When the workforce you choose comes out on top rated. For your Yankees, the underdogs, you have only to pay $150 to secure a shot at that hundred bucks. But, naturally, the Yankees will have to earn!

The other form of wager created on sporting activities would be the spread. Listed here, bookmakers will offer bettors a chance to gain whether or not the team they wager on loses. This is a take a look at how spreads are expressed:

Chicago Bulls -ten
Denver Nuggets

Again, the damaging indication indicates the Bulls are the favourite. However, In cases like this, a bettor wagers not on just who'll win, but by the amount of. For those who had been to wager to the Bulls and they won, but only by 8, you'll continue to shed the wager. The Bulls really need to gain by more than 10 points if a bet on them is always to return dollars. Conversely, you could potentially guess on the underdog Nuggets and nevertheless acquire If your staff loses by fewer than ten details.
